How to Make Grilled Carrot (Traditional & Healthy Version)
Grilled Carrot, or Lobak Bakar, is a vibrant Malaysian vegetarian dish that beautifully showcases the rich multicultural flavors of Malaysia. Carrots are marinated with a blend of local spices, lemongrass (serai), and a hint of pandan leaf, then grilled to perfection. This dish is a celebration of simplicity, allowing the natural sweetness of the carrot to shine while being enhanced by aromatic Malaysian herbs and spices. In Malaysia, grilling or 'bakar' techniques are deeply rooted in both Malay and Peranakan culinary traditions. Grilled vegetables, although not as common as satay or ikan bakar, have grown popular at modern cafes and health-conscious eateries, representing a fusion of traditional flavors with contemporary healthy eating trends. Bahan-bahan(untuk 1 medium grilled carrot with herb marinade, sliced)
- 4 medium Carrots (peeled, locally sourced)
- 1 tablespoon Olive oil (or minyak zaitun)
- 1 stalk Lemongrass (serai, finely chopped)
- 1 small leaf Pandan leaf (daun pandan, tied in knot) - pilihan
- 2 cloves Garlic (finely minced)
- 1-inch piece Ginger (halia, grated)
- 1 teaspoon Honey (or madu, optional for glaze) - pilihan
- 1/2 teaspoon Salt (to taste)
- 1/4 teaspoon Black pepper (freshly ground)
- 2 tablespoons Coriander leaves (daun ketumbar, chopped, for garnish) - pilihan
Arahan
- 1
Wash, peel, and cut carrots lengthwise into thick sticks or halves for even grilling.
5 minutes
Cut carrots uniformly to ensure even cooking.
- 2
Prepare the marinade by mixing olive oil, lemongrass, garlic, ginger, salt, black pepper, and honey (if using) in a bowl.
3 minutes
Bruise the lemongrass for a more aromatic marinade.
- 3
Coat the carrot pieces thoroughly in the marinade. Add pandan leaf for extra aroma.
2 minutes
Allow carrots to marinate for at least 10 minutes for deeper flavor.
- 4
Preheat a grill pan or barbecue to medium heat. Lightly oil the grill surface.
3 minutes
Use a non-stick grill mat if grilling outdoors.

This Grilled Carrot recipe is a healthy choice because it focuses on nutrient-dense vegetables, uses minimal oil, and avoids deep-frying or heavy sauces. The natural sweetness of carrots is preserved, while the marinade adds flavor without excess calories. It fits well into vegetarian, weight loss, and diabetic meal plans due to its low glycemic load, high fiber, and absence of processed ingredients.
Carrots are rich in beta-carotene, vitamin A, and antioxidants, supporting eye health and immune function. This grilled approach uses minimal oil, keeping fat content low while enhancing natural flavors with lemongrass and ginger, both known for their anti-inflammatory properties. With no added refined sugars and a moderate amount of healthy fats from olive oil, this dish is also cholesterol-free and suitable for most dietary needs. The inclusion of herbs like coriander adds further micronutrients such as vitamin C and K.
Petua
- 💡Tip 1: Marinate the carrots overnight for a deeper, more complex flavor.
- 💡Tip 2: Thread carrot sticks onto bamboo skewers for easy flipping on the grill.
- 💡Tip 3: Sprinkle toasted sesame seeds or crushed peanuts for a Malaysian crunch.
Penyimpanan & hidangan
Store leftover grilled carrots in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at gently in a pan or oven to preserve texture.
